On Mon, 29 Mar 2004, Scheldebouw wrote: > When using the email proxy with "MAPS" can I, by adding a rule before the > email proxy rule, allow hosts that are on the defined MAPS blacklists and > therefore bypassing the blacklist check or email proxy for those hosts?
No, unfortunately there is no whitelist mechanism. > One of our major clients got blacklisted last week by two of the MAPS > blacklists we use and disabling those blacklists (we obviously can't ignore > the clients email) has immediately increased the amount of incoming spam. > > Or any other suggestions for this problem? Unfortunately, I've found that the Gnatbox email proxy just is'nt up to dealing with the current level of spam. I gave up on the email proxy awhile ago and now I have my email server set up to do all the blocking.
